Coatings for biological interface on implants

1. A method of forming a coating having a surface with exposed features thereon, comprising:
forming a coating upon a substrate; the coating comprising a biocompatible controlled release polymer and at least one active component; and
depositing fibers onto an outermost surface of the coating to form the exposed features, wherein the features include micrometer scale features and nanometer scale features that rise above the outermost surface of the coating, and wherein the outermost surface is also exposed.
